Transaction deba7c63e17890bc7da7db95fe9e5bcc3042876cbee2e93fb2c4a70ab11379de
1 Input
1 Output
-
deba7c63e17890bc7da7db95fe9e5bcc3042876cbee2e93fb2c4a70ab11379de:0
- value
- 17239
- script pubkey
- OP_0 OP_PUSHBYTES_32 d9838a516038621477561f7590c8947c81b72d482645db0c8404d9d087de9140
- address
- bc1qmxpc55tq8p3pga6kra6epjy50jqmwt2gyezakryyqnvapp77j9qqcyksxa